Skip to content

Commit aa5a9a4

Browse files
authored
Merge pull request #76 from deploymenttheory/dev
Fix console encoding separator in logger configuration
2 parents 23b5213 + 7187f0e commit aa5a9a4

File tree

1 file changed

+3
-1
lines changed

1 file changed

+3
-1
lines changed

logger/zaplogger_config.go

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-40,7 +40,9 @@ func BuildLogger(logLevel LogLevel, encoding string, logConsoleSeparator string)
4040
encoderCfg.EncodeName = zapcore.FullNameEncoder // Encodes the logger's name as-is, without any modifications.
4141

4242
// Console-specific settings (if using console encoding)
43-
encoderCfg.ConsoleSeparator = logConsoleSeparator // Separator character used in console encoding.
43+
if encoding == "console" {
44+
encoderCfg.ConsoleSeparator = logConsoleSeparator
45+
}
4446

4547
// Convert the custom LogLevel to zap's logging level
4648
zapLogLevel := convertToZapLevel(logLevel)

0 commit comments

Comments
 (0)